Transaction 2407faeed5ebfe0291cc0424534ac2a17b175fd7d2bf6d15f2e57f986694eb04

1 Input
2 Outputs
  • 2407faeed5ebfe0291cc0424534ac2a17b175fd7d2bf6d15f2e57f986694eb04:0
  • value  195008959
    address  32K7kpZuxnfVMLWBp3jnCVq3wu3AM5yzZA
  • 2407faeed5ebfe0291cc0424534ac2a17b175fd7d2bf6d15f2e57f986694eb04:1
  • value  4981041
    address  3Pp9cyYPJfjB85kLeiKBTXJ1njxtYZBj2a